William "Bill" Goichberg (born 1942) is a rated chess master and is the current President of the United States Chess Federation. He was elected USCF President on August 14, 2005. He is a USCF Life Master and a FIDE Master, National Tournament Director and International Arbiter of FIDE (World Chess Federation).  He joined IM John Watson for his weekly Chess Talk and the interview will be available as a special bonus on WCL for all members.

For the ninth year running the XIX Internet Chess Tournament "Ciudad de Dos Hermanas" (Spain) was being held on the ICC playing zone (www.chessclub.com). As usual, registration for the event was completely free both for ICC members and non-members!

NECF-InSchools is the handle of the famous Jorge Sammour-Hasbun who battled against an impressive field of titled players, including top players Shahriyar Mamedyarov, Tigran L. Petrosian, Gata Kamsky, Hikaru Nakamura, Kiril Georgiev, Sergey Shipov and this year's finalist our popular site Pro GM Ronen Har-Zvi (Indiana-Jones on ICC). More than 600 chess fans were in audience. Jorge Hasbun won the match 4-1.  

This event is clearly the most important Internet chess tournament in the world, featuring the biggest number of participants. In the 2008 edition, the records have been broken with 5455 players participating in the 12 qualifiers. Not only that, but in qualifier 5, the all-time Dos Hermanas attendance record was smashed with 583 players (553, in 2004).
 
This year the prize fund was 7,700 € (roughly $12,000), with 2,000 € (roughly $3,400) for the winner. In addition, there are many class prizes and special cash prizes for amateur players. Also, winners can achieve the opportunity to travel to Dos Hermanas for the main Event, with Topalov, Shirov, Polgar and Vallejo, at the end of April.

Predict a Move - An Event with PRIZES !

Started  January 1st, PAM (Predict-a-Move) is rolling. Every day at 13:00 EDT, you can join the line just type "tell PAM-bot join".
The rule is simple. A game played by 2 masters is chosen in a database and the members have to guess what is the move that has been played by white as well as black. Any guess within the 30 first seconds gives you 25 points. The right guess gives 75 points, so, the right guess found in less than 30 seconds means 100 points.
Of course, it is not allowed to search the game in a database in order to guess(?) the move. We hope you understand that cheating is just detrimental.
You can join, leave and come back without losing your points.

PRIZES : Each month the best player will be awarded with a 3 weeks membership extension and the player who has played the most during the month (with a minimun score of 3000 points for the whole month) will get 1 week membership extension! the winner of the best can't be, the same month, also winner of the most and can't be awarded for the best score, twice in a row but he can play for the most then.

From the above, you know for example that the Tournament named "Valley Of The Kings" is in its 3rd round of 5 (3/5), it is a blitz rated (br) with a time control of 3 0 played with the Swiss Style (SW) pairing method. Clicking on the will give you the actual standings, the games in progress, the list of players and more details on tournaments in general. Littleper (channel 225) hosts this tournament.
E2 E1 or SW stand for the styles. Ex is a tournament by elimination where x is the maximum of losses you can have before finishing (and losing) the tourney. E2 means you can lose one game but at the second loss you are done! Beware also, if you latejoin, each round missed counts as a loss. SW is for Swiss style where player with  similar scores play each other but max 1 time each.
